Product Description

by Henri De Riedmatten (Editor), Fabio Gaffo (Editor), Mathilde Jaccard (Editor)

Die Publikation widmet sich den Beziehungen zwischen Restaurierung und Politik in der Kunst der italienischen Renaissance. Die Frage nach der Herkunft als Grundlage politischer, patrimonialer und kultureller Identit舩 bildet den Fokus der Betrachtungen. Anstatt urspr?gliche Formen und Bedeutungen wiederherzustellen, wurde die Vergangenheit entsprechend neuen Identit舩sbed?fnissen umgestaltet: R舫me wurden umorganisiert und Kunstwerke mit neuen Bedeutungen versehen. Die materielle und 舖thetische Realit舩 der Kunstgegenst舅de erfuhr somit eine Umgestaltung und Neudefinition. Ziel der Beitr臠e ist es, mliche physische Ver舅derungen der Artefakte im Lichte ihrer symbolischen Umkodierung zu analysieren.

Author Biography

Henri de Riedmatten, Swiss National Science Foundation (SNSF) Professor at the Department of Art History, University of Geneva, since 2018 leading the SNSF research project "Restoration as Fabrication of Origins: A Material and Political History of Italian Renaissance Art". His current research is devoted to issues of iconoclasm and restoration in Renaissance Italy.

Fabio Gaffo, PhD candidate in the SNSF research project "Restoration as Fabrication of Origins: A Material and Political History of Italian Renaissance Art," University of Geneva, Switzerland.

Mathilde Jaccard, PhD candidate in the SNSF research project "Restoration as Fabrication of Origins: A Material and Political History of Italian Renaissance Art," University of Geneva, Switzerland.
